the Question parameters
 Accumulate scores of voted responses :
The most common way of calculating scores.
The points of each answer given by participants are
accumulated.
 Only correct responses voted, otherwise nil score :
You have to give ALL the answers with a positive
score and ONLY the answers with a positive score,
otherwise you gain 0 point.
 Classify responses according to preference :
It automatically gives a coefficient to the answers
according to the voting order.
 Order responses correctly :
To have the points, you have to give the correct
sequence of answers.

Checking the batteries
Checking the batteries - 1
 Click on the PowerVote toolbar Keypads management
command
 Go on the « Receiver » tab, then click on « Battery
checking »
Checking the batteries - 2
 You will be asked to push on any button of each keypad
which you want to check, then click on « OK »
 On each keypad will be displayed the battery status
(it will disappear after a few seconds)
Between 30 and 90  OK
Under 30  change batteries
